Corned Beef and Cabbage
A set-and-forget classic — corned beef simmered with potatoes, carrots, and cabbage until everything's fork tender.

One of the simplest dishes to prepare with minimum input for maximum output. Set and forget the corned beef on the stovetop, in a slow cooker, or in the oven (our favorite) and let your kitchen fill with the aroma.
